Package Body Material: PLASTIC/EPOXY
Provides durability and protection for the diode, making it suitable for various applications.
Surface Mount: YES
Allows for easy and convenient installation on circuit boards, saving space and facilitating automated assembly processes.
Maximum Operating Temperature: 175 °C
Ensures reliable performance even in high-temperature environments.
Diode Type: RECTIFIER DIODE
Designed specifically for rectifying alternating current, making it ideal for power applications.
Maximum Forward Voltage (VF): 0.59 V
Low forward voltage drop helps in reducing power loss and increasing efficiency.
Maximum Output Current: 3 A
Capable of handling high current loads, suitable for power applications.
Technology: SCHOTTKY
Schottky diodes have fast switching speeds and low forward voltage drop, making them efficient for power applications.
Maximum Repetitive Peak Reverse Voltage: 200 V
Suitable for applications requiring high reverse voltage protection.
Diode Element Material: SILICON
Provides good electrical conductivity and performance characteristics for the diode.
